Let's first look at the charging initiative of new energy vehicle owners. Its starting point is to optimize the allocation and utilization of power resources. During the peak period of electricity consumption in summer, the power supply faces great pressure. After 11 o'clock at night, the overall electricity consumption is relatively low. Charging new energy vehicles at this time can reduce the burden on the power grid during peak hours and improve the stability and efficiency of the power system.
